In the Joyous Service, there are three parts of the hand dance that is performed. The first and third parts are prayers asking God to sweep the evil thoughts from others, to save them:
Evil thoughts sweeping, save them please. 1st part
Heaven’s truth Saving God.
Evil thoughts sweeping, save them quickly 3rd part
Everyone purified, the Kanrodai
But the 2nd part appears to be out of place? It is not a prayer. But is it really out of place or does it have a purpose?
I believe that the 2nd part of the prayer, God is telling us what to tell people before we perform the prayer. We must spread God’s truth about the Original pure mind.God is telling us what to say to convince people to accept the teachings that will save them. We need to spread the teachings to kara, or the people that do not know the teaching. The following is the 2nd part:
Just a word to you, what God is saying listen please
Evil things, spoken not.
These workings of (human creation), earth and heaven representing,
wife/husband created and brought forth.
This is this world’s beginning.
Why is the origin of human beings so important to convey? In the Ofudesaki, God tells us we need to understand the Origin. God wants people to understand the Original pure mind of God that was given to the first couple from heaven. This is a mind without, regret, covetousness, self-love, greed, and arrogance. From the earth in the muddy ancient ocean, a fish and sea serpent was selected to become the first parents. Finally, the good qualities of other sea creatures from the muddy ancient ocean was added to the first couple to begin human beings. With the perfect body, and the pure mind from God, we should be able to live the Joyous life, but evil thoughts have infiltrated our mind. This is why there is suffering and illness in this world. The Original mind from heaven is the mind that God wants us to return to. When our minds are pure, only joy will come from our hearts.
In summary, our prayer serves two purposes. One it tells us what to convey to people to help them understand the teaching, and 2nd, it is asking God to help with this endeavor to attain the Original pure mind to the people who do not accept the teachings, especially of the Original pure mind. When God accepts our prayer, God places illness as guidance to help kara understand what evil thoughts are in their minds, and also understand what their own hearts/souls do. We have a powerful tool in the Joyous Service to save the world, but only if we use it as it was intended. We must spread the truth of the Original pure mind, and how to attain it!

In the Ofudesaki, the words nihon and kara are found. What are kara and nihon? They appears to refer to types of people. What are you, kara or nihon? The definition of kara is without, or empty. So one may ask, what are the people of kara without? As for nihon, these people must have something or somethings that kara does not have.
The people of nihon have the understanding of the Original pure mind (shinjitsu), and the heart/soul (mune). The Original pure mind is a mind without regret, covetousness, self-love, greed, and arrogance. God wants us to attain this mind. When we attain this mind, we will attain happiness. How do we attain tthis mind? God tells us we must understand our own hearts/souls (mune). It is our own heart/souls that monitors our behaviors. Because of our own hearts/souls, we reap what we have sowed. God tells us when fate from our own hearts appears, we must ponder our own minds of these evil thoughts. When we continually do this, we can purify our own minds. When our minds are pure, only joy will come from our own hearts/souls.
In summary, the people of nihon understand the Original pure mind, and know how to purify their own minds by understanding what comes from their own hearts/souls. They know by attaining the Original pure mind, they will have joy in their lives. The people of kara do not know these teachings that are in the Ofudesaki.
For many, the attainment of the Original pure mind is what God expects. But for some, they would want to share God’s truth with others. They want the people of kara to become nihon. How does this happen? God tells us we must tell the people of kara about the Original pure mind (shinjitsu) and the heart/soul (mune). For a few, just giving them the information, they will understand the Original pure mind and the heart, and will proceed to purify their minds. They will become nihon. For other, they will need more convincing. This is where God comes into play.
God has given the people of nihon a special prayer called the Joyous Service. This is a prayer asking God to sweep the evil thoughts from the people of kara who we have spread the truth of the Original pure mind, and the heart/soul. God by the acceptance of our pure mind, will place illness on these people as guidance to help them understand what their own hearts do to purify their minds. These people will then come to our places of worship to be healed, and further informed of the Original pure mind, and the heart/soul to purify their own minds. By this process, the whole world will eventually become nihon!
